What Defines a Luxury Pram?
A luxury pram is identified not merely by its cost, however by the quality of its elements and the precision of its assembly. While basic strollers focus on fundamental performance, luxury models prioritize the "ride quality." This involves innovative suspension systems that imitate the smooth handling of a high-end car, making sure that a sleeping infant remains undisturbed even when browsing unequal cobblestones or cracked city pathways.
Additionally, the materials used in luxury prams are of a greater quality. Rather of fundamental plastic and standard polyester, one will discover lightweight aluminum or carbon fiber frames, hand-stitched leatherette handles, and materials that are both breathable and sustainably sourced.
Secret Features of High-End Models
- Advanced Suspension Systems: Many luxury brands utilize all-wheel suspension or adjustable rear suspension to soak up shocks.
- Modular Design: These prams typically grow with the kid, transitioning from a lie-flat carrycot for newborns to a reversible seat unit for toddlers.
- One-Handed Operation: High-end engineering permits moms and dads to fold the chassis or change the seat recline with a single hand.
- Aesthetic Customization: From designer partnerships to limited-edition colorways, high-end prams provide a level of personalization rarely seen in mass-market items.

quicker. 2. High Resale Value Unlike many child products that lose nearly all worth when used, luxury prams maintain a significant portion of their initial list price. Brands like Bugaboo and Silver Cross have robust secondary markets, permitting moms and dads to recover a largepercentage of their investment when the kid grows out of the stroller. 3. Ergonomics for Parent and Child Engineers of luxury strollers spend countless hours investigating spinal positioning for infants and postural health for parents. Functions such as telescoping handlebars make sure that parents of different heights can push the pram without straining their backs, while ergonomic seat inlays supply ideal support for an establishing child's hips and spinal column. Essential Accessories for the Luxury Experience To really optimize the utility and style of a high-end pram, numerous parents go with specialized devices. These additions are frequently created specifically for the design to make sure a best fit and aesthetic harmony.Sheepskin Liners: Naturally thermoregulating liners that keep the child warm in winter and cool in summer. Integrated Parasols: UV-protected umbrellas that connect straight to the chassis to provide targeted shade. Designer Changing Bags: High-end brand names frequently partner with style homes to produce matching bags that clip securely onto the pram deal with. Winter Season Footmuffs: Thick, fleece-lined cocoons that get rid of theneed for large blankets throughout cold trips. Cup Holders and Smartphone Mounts: Precision-engineered attachments for adult benefit. Categorizing Luxury Prams by Lifestyle Not every high-end pram is suitable for every environment. Recognizing the primary use case is essential before purchasing. The All-Terrain Adventurer For families who delight in nature tracks and rural strolls, an all-terrain high-end pram is a necessity. These designs feature larger, foam-filled or air-filled tires and a more robust frame. The Bugaboo Fox and Mamas & Papas Ocarro stand out in this category, using stability on turf, gravel, and sand. The Urban Commuter City living demands a pram that is light-weight and narrow enough to browse crowded stores and public transport. The Cybex Mios or the Bugaboo Bee are engineered for this purpose, offering a compact fold without compromising the premium products and smooth"push "associated with high-end
